A family is living through moments of anguish as they await news of a missing 66-year-old Spanish businessman who reportedly fell overboard in the Ionian Sea, off the coast of Pylos, Greece. According to his family, he fell into the sea on August 18 and has not been heard from since. “The only thing my mother wrote were my father’s coordinates. Full stop — there is nothing else written. My mother did not keep a diary, my mother did not write how she felt,” his son said in a statement to Mega television.

Pylos: “In 30 seconds, my father was gone”
The son of the 66-year-old man spoke to the Live News program, recounting the events that led to his father’s disappearance. “Last Sunday I spoke with my parents — they were going to leave Syracuse, Italy, heading for Pylos, Greece. On Monday, at around 7:00 in the morning,” he said.
“At 150 nautical miles out, my father caught a tuna, cleaned the tuna, and as he took a bucket to wash away the blood left behind, my father fell overboard. My mother, due to the shock, did not know how to react. On top of that, the boat was one they were not very familiar with — she did not know how to respond, and within 30 seconds my father had disappeared,” he added.
“After that, my mother took down the exact, precise coordinates of the spot where my father fell and tried to send out an SOS via radio. The radio appears to have either malfunctioned or the correct protocol was not followed,” he stressed.
“My mother is not crazy”
“The boat ran out of fuel because my mother knew nothing about mechanics — she did not know how to turn off the engine or anything else. She managed to raise one of the sails and lowered the other about halfway to slow the vessel down as much as possible.
She wrote down the coordinates where my father fell, which were immediately reported to the Maritime Rescue Service. The only thing my mother wrote were my father’s coordinates. Full stop — there is nothing else written. My mother did not keep a diary, my mother did not write how she felt. My mother is not crazy, she is not taking any medication,” he said. He went on to describe his father as a seasoned sailor: “My father has been sailing for over 35 years. He was an extraordinarily experienced man. My mother, not so much.”
